The Power of MRI in Proactive Health Management

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) is a cutting-edge medical diagnostic technique that allows for non-invasive and painless examination of the body’s internal structures with exceptional clarity. Unlike X-rays or CT scans, MRI does not use ionizing radiation, making it a safer option for repeated use. Its unmatched ability to differentiate between different types of tissues makes it invaluable for early detection and diagnosis.

Conditions Detectable Through Proactive MRI Scans

Neurological Conditions

Early detection of neurological conditions can have a significant impact on treatment outcomes. MRI scans are highly effective in identifying brain tumors, strokes, aneurysms, and neurodegenerative diseases like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s.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) has revolutionized the way we approach neurological conditions. By generating high-resolution images of the brain and spinal cord, MRI provides a detailed look at neurological structures and vascular systems without exposure to radiation. This capability is crucial for identifying brain tumors, as MRIs can distinguish between benign and malignant growths, pinpoint their exact location, and determine their effect on surrounding tissues. For stroke detection, MRI is invaluable in differentiating between ischemic (caused by blood clots) and hemorrhagic (caused by bleeding) strokes, which is essential for administering the correct treatment. In cases of aneurysms, MRI can visualize the blood vessels’ structure, identifying weaknesses before they rupture. For neurodegenerative diseases like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s, MRI helps in spotting brain atrophy patterns characteristic of these conditions, facilitating early intervention and management strategies..

Cancer Detection

Early cancer detection is crucial, and MRI plays a vital role in this. MRI’s sensitivity to soft tissue contrast is a game-changer in cancer detection, particularly for cancers of the breast, prostate, and liver. Its ability to provide detailed images helps in identifying even small tumors, often before they are palpable or symptomatic. For breast cancer, MRI can detect tumors in dense breast tissue where mammograms may not be as effective. In prostate cancer, MRI offers a non-invasive method to assess the prostate gland’s size, shape, and any suspicious lesions, guiding biopsies and treatment planning. Liver cancer detection benefits from MRI’s capacity to differentiate between benign and malignant lesions and to assess the liver’s overall health, aiding in surgical planning and the evaluation of treatment efficacy. Cardiovascular Diseases

Heart disease continues to be a leading global cause of death. However, early detection through MRI plays a vital role in providing individuals with a fighting chance. MRI stands out in cardiovascular disease management by offering precise imagery of the heart’s structure and function, along with the blood vessels. Cardiac MRI can assess myocardial damage from heart attacks, detect heart muscle diseases (cardiomyopathies), and evaluate congenital heart defects. It plays a pivotal role in identifying blockages in blood vessels, contributing to the planning of interventions such as stenting or bypass surgery. Furthermore, MRI’s ability to visualize the heart in motion helps in diagnosing functional issues, such as heart failure, by evaluating ejection fractions and cardiac output.

Musculoskeletal Disorders

If you’re experiencing joint pain, stiffness, or injury, an MRI is a crucial tool for early diagnosis and treatment planning. In diagnosing musculoskeletal disorders, MRI’s superiority lies in its detailed visualization of bone marrow, soft tissues, and their interfaces. This is crucial for early detection of degenerative joint diseases, where changes in cartilage thickness and composition can be monitored. MRI’s sensitivity is beneficial in identifying early stages of bone tumors, distinguishing between benign and malignant types based on their appearance and growth pattern. Soft tissue injuries, including tendon and ligament tears, are clearly visible on MRI, allowing for precise assessment and guiding rehabilitation or surgical repair. Spinal Conditions

Back pain is a prevalent condition that can be indicative of underlying spinal disorders.For spinal conditions, MRI provides unparalleled views of the spinal column, nerves, and discs. It is particularly effective in diagnosing disc herniation, where MRI can show the exact location and extent of the herniation and its impact on nearby spinal nerves. Spinal stenosis, a narrowing of the spinal canal causing pressure on spinal nerves, and tumors within the spinal column or affecting the vertebrae, are also clearly identified on MRI. This detailed imaging facilitates targeted treatment plans, from conservative management to surgical interventions, improving patient outcomes and quality of life.
